Study Summary
This will be a non-blinded feasibility (pilot) study comparing triple therapy nebulizer vs dry powdered inhalers (DPI) for care transitions in Chronic obstructive pulmonary disease (COPD) exacerbation patients. We hypothesize that patients treated in hospital and discharged on respiratory medications administered by nebulizers will exhibit better quality of life (QoL), symptom control, and lower COPD and all cause hospital readmission rates compared with patients treated with respiratory medications delivered by DPI. We aim to demonstrate that: 1. Patients treated and discharged on nebulized bronchodilators will have fewer readmissions to hospital at 30 and 90 days compared to the group utilizing DPI 2. The nebulizer group will demonstrate a longer duration of time until hospital readmission for COPD and all cause readmission compared to the group utilizing DPI 3. The nebulizer group will demonstrate better QoL (measured by the SGRQ - Saint George Respiratory Questionnaire) and symptom control (as measured by the CAT \& mMRC) compared to the group utilizing DPI.
Interventions
- DEVICE Dry Powder Inhaler
- DRUG Pulmicort
- DEVICE Nebulizers
- DRUG Brovana
- DRUG Atrovent
